I use Soundfont for Drum tracks. Gold Drums. Sequence em in PIII 870, 256MB, 20 GB (System) & 3,2GB (Audio) both 5400 rpm, running SONAR 2 XL, Win XP Home, SB Live! DE 5.1 card, driver WDM from Microsoft. In SONAR's Audio Options, set the mixing latency to 120ms. Sampling rate to 44100Hz, Audio driver Bit depth 16. Synchronization to Full Chase Lock. Finish sequencing, I turn to record 'em to stereo audio file. Arm the track, set the rec source from MIDI, and hit the record button. Nice recorded.
But hey... The longer I record the song, the higher the latency ocur. The result was well sync in the first ones measures, but as the song rolling, the result become more "slided" and I get about 220 tick distance at measure 130. I record on tempo 126. I record again and again after playing around with Audio, Project & Global Setting in Options. Negative. Any idea how to solve this MIDI -record to audio- latency ? Thank's.
